David Jensen – A Biography
David is an accountant on the team at Humphries Associates, he worked here part time for four years and started full time in 2010.
His role at Humphries Associates is primarily to prepare financial accounts and transaction returns, as well as to work alongside our more senior accountants in other complex projects.
He is also the go to guy at Humphries Associates for maintaining our internal systems and accounting software.
Educational Background
David completed a Bachelor of Business in Accounting and Management in 2008, and a Graduate Diploma in Business in 2009 at the Auckland University of Technology.
He is currently in his last year of working towards being a fully Chartered Accountant.
